A Tract on Monetary Reform is one of John Maynard Keynes’s seminal works, originally published in 1923, where he addresses the critical issues surrounding monetary policy in the post-World War I era. In this influential text, Keynes explores the economic consequences of fluctuations in the value of money, particularly focusing on the effects of inflation and deflation on society, public finance, and international trade.
The 2nd edition of the book continues to offer timeless insights into the challenges faced by policymakers in stabilizing prices, maintaining currency value, and promoting economic stability. Keynes argues for flexible monetary policies that adapt to changing economic circumstances rather than rigid adherence to the gold standard, emphasizing the importance of price stability for economic growth and social equity.
Keynes’s analysis extends beyond theoretical discussion, providing practical recommendations for monetary reform tailored to different countries, including Great Britain and the United States. His work laid foundational ideas that influenced later economic thought and policy, especially during the Great Depression and the development of modern macroeconomics.
